WebNeck ultrasound is the best imaging test to evaluate thyroid nodules, because it can detect features that have been proven to predict malignancy. The American Thyroid Association has published evidence- based ultrasound criteria for evaluating thyroid nodules for the possibility of cancer. WebJun 14, 2024 · A CT scan of your head and neck – CT, or computed tomography, scans are not typically used for assessing your thyroid gland but they can be used in certain situations (5). Most of the time, thyroid gland findings on a CT scan are found incidentally usually when someone gets a CT scan of their chest looking for something abnormal there. The thyroid cartilage consists of bilateral flattened laminae that are fused anteriorly in the median plane to form the laryngeal prominence. Each lamina possesses an oblique ridge with a tubercle superiorly and inferiorly. Posteriorly, its borders are free and project upwards and downwards as the superior and inferior horns.

WebParathyroid four-dimensional computed tomography (4DCT) is a technique that uses sophisticated x-ray technology to locate the parathyroid glands in the neck. CT scanning is fast, painless, noninvasive and accurate. Parathyroid 4DCT is a more specialized CT scan with greater ability to locate diseased glands. WebIn adult patients undergoing neck CT, the thyroid dose can be estimated by taking into account the amount of radiation used to perform the CT examination (CTDI vol), the scanning length, patient size, and variation of radiation intensity due to automatic tube current modulation.
